Moving Subjects (Sports)

Shoot continuously as the camera focuses on moving subjects.

There may be a delay after continuous shooting before you can shoot again.
Note that some types of memory cards may delay your next shot even
longer.
Shooting may slow down depending on shooting conditions, camera settings,
and the zoom position.

2
Focus.
z
z
While you are pressing the shutter button
halfway, the camera will continue to
adjust focus and image brightness where
the blue frame is displayed.
3
Shoot.
z
z
Hold the shutter button all the way down
to shoot continuously.
z
z
Shooting stops when you release the
shutter button or reach the maximum
number of shots, after which [Busy] is
displayed and the shots are shown in the
order you took them.
